Maybe you’ve heard my woe-is-me-I-missed-SXSW tale, maybe not. One of the biggest regrets I had about missing the festival was missing out on the multiple opportunities I would have had to see LIONS, hometown favorites in Austin.

I’ve said this to people before and have done LIONS a total disservice but I think of their sound as the type Kid Rock would have if he grew up on Sabbath and Blue Cheer (ie early stoner rock) rather than Skynryd (it’s the vocals … Matt D doesn’t do the whole rap-rock thing but there is something in his voice that reminds me of Rock’s when Rock is waving his metal freak flag). Rick Allen of The Other Paper said they sound like Soundgarden pre-Ben Sheppard era.

Cruise_Elroy from the DW message board says the band’s live performance blows away the record stuff which I think is pretty mindblowing itself (check out No Generation, one of those “wish I would have heard this in 2007 so I could have put it on my Best of list” CDs, for recorded evidence). And Cruise also made a Columbus connection to LIONS – lead singer Matt Drenik’s brother Jason is a founding member of Columbus’s Hairy Patt Band.

In the past year LIONS have toured with the Toadies and Blue Cheer and following this short stint of headlining dates will do a few weeks with Local H (damn, Cleveland is the closest show).

Australian songwriter Ohad Rein has performed at SXSW in the past, both as a touring member of Gelbison (2004) and fronting his own band, Old Man River (2005). Rein and his band, which includes former Noise Addict drummer Saul Smith, will once again be returning to Austin to play SXSW according to the band’s MySpace page.

Got an email from Tilly & The Wall this evening confirming their participation at SXSW though exact details haven’t been revealed yet.

And, Austin stoner-rockers Lions, whose song “Metal Heavy Lady” is featured on Guitar Hero 3, are playing the High Times party and will undoubtedly play a million shows over the course of 4 days.
